Adjacent Local Binary Patterns Based on Color Space Fusion for Color Image Classification |
|
|
Abstract In this paper, we propose an improved image feature descriptor based
on Local Binary Pattern, which is called Adjacent Local Binary
Patterns based on Color Space Fusion (ALBPCSF). The proposed method
fuses color feature and spatial relations. ALBPCSF uses the channel
values of RGB and HSV color spaces to calculate the color feature.
Then the proposed method considers the spatial relations which will
be combined with the color feature. Finally, an image classification
system framework based on ALBPCSF is given. In order to validate the
performance, our method is compared with previous methods on Corel
1000 and MIT Vision Texture datasets. The results show that our
approach is superior than other methods in color image
classification.
